From Solid Power, Inc.'s Latest SEC 10-K Filing (filed 2026-02-25)
Key Strengths & Strategy (as disclosed to the SEC)
- This business model distinguishes us from competitors who are, or plan to be, commercial battery manufacturers and allows us to focus on our core strength of electrolyte development and production.
- Benefits of Our Technology We believe our electrolyte has the potential to provide the following benefits when incorporated into a solid-state cell as compared to traditional lithium-ion batteries: If our electrolyte proves successful at delivering these benefits, we believe it would allow for reduced costs of battery packs through reduction of expensive pack engineering. 2025 Business Highlights Drove electrolyte innovation and performance through feedback from cell development and customers .
- We believe we are the only entity with both pilot-scale sulfide electrolyte manufacturing and pilot-scale solid-state cell manufacturing capabilities, which positions us to utilize feedback from our internal cell development team as well as feedback from customers and other external parties to improve our electrolyte products.
- The expansion is designed to further our technology roadmap and support anticipated small volume programs of current and future customers as they begin to transition from traditional lithium-ion to solid-state battery technology.
